Last week, the world mourned the loss of Henry Kissinger, who passed away at the remarkable age of 100. Renowned journalist and author, George Packer, along with the insightful @DKThomp, a staff writer at The Atlantic, delve into the complex legacy left behind by this former Secretary of State.

Henry Kissinger was a figure of great influence and controversy. As one of the most prominent diplomats in American history, his impact on foreign policy cannot be understated. However, his actions and decisions have been the subject of intense debate and criticism.

In this thought-provoking piece, Packer and @DKThomp explore the intricacies of Kissinger’s legacy. They analyze his role in shaping US foreign policy, particularly during the tumultuous era of the Vietnam War. The authors delve into the consequences of his realpolitik approach, which prioritized national interests and power dynamics over moral considerations.

The article delves into Kissinger’s involvement in the controversial bombing campaigns in Cambodia and Laos, which resulted in the loss of numerous innocent lives. Packer and @DKThomp critically examine the ethical implications of these actions, questioning the balance between national security and humanitarian concerns.

Moreover, the authors reflect on Kissinger’s contributions to diplomacy and his efforts in shaping US relations with China and the Soviet Union. They highlight how his pursuit of detente with these nations had long-lasting effects on global politics and the Cold War.

Throughout the article, Packer and @DKThomp provide a comprehensive analysis of Kissinger’s legacy, weighing the successes and failures of his foreign policy decisions. They acknowledge his strategic brilliance but also confront the ethical dilemmas and human costs associated with his approach.
